@media(max-width:767px){.elementor-112 .elementor-element.elementor-element-467e61f{padding:0px 0px 0px 0px;}.elementor-112 .elementor-element.elementor-element-c9b90e1 > .elementor-element-populated{padding:0px 0px 0px 0px;}}/* Start custom CSS for section, class: .elementor-element-467e61f */.contactwrapper section.contact.contact-pt.gray-bg {
    padding: 60px 20px;
}
button.thm-btn {
    background-color: #384253;
    fill: #FFFFFF;
    color: #FFFFFF;
    border-radius: 50px 50px 50px 50px;
    padding: 20px 30px 20px 30px;
}

.col-12 {}

button.thm-btn:hover {
    background-color: #1F2736;
}

button.thm-btn:focus {
    background-color: #1F2736;
}/* End custom CSS */